Fiberlogy ESD PETG Antistatic Filament

The PETG ESD filament from Fiberlogy has been specially developed to provide protection against electrostatic discharge (ESD), one of the main threats to electronic components. This material features antistatic properties and high energy dissipation, making it suitable for preventing damage or reducing the risk of failure in sensitive electronic devices.

Electrostatic discharges can cause irreparable damage to integrated circuits, sensors, connectors, and measuring devices, resulting in high maintenance and repair costs. In environments where conditions favor the occurrence of ESD, PETG ESD acts as an effective protective barrier, ensuring greater safety in the manufacturing of these components.

PETG ESD is the perfect choice for FDM technology-based creation of parts and housings for electronic devices, displays, connectors, and specialized tools. This material is widely used in the production of tools for working with electronic components and in the manufacturing of machinery and equipment used in production plants, thanks to its ability to prevent the harmful effects of electrostatic discharges. Moreover, PETG ESD filament is not only ideal for electronic components but also for industrial applications and in the manufacturing sector.

Fiberlogy’s PETG ESD stands out for its high mechanical strength, which allows it to withstand demanding conditions without losing its antistatic properties. This material is easy to print, as it does not require a heated chamber and has low moisture absorption, improving print quality and simplifying the manufacturing process. In addition, its durability and chemical resistance make it a reliable and cost-effective option for companies seeking to minimize the risk of electronic component failure.

General information

Material PETG
Format Spool
Density (ISO 1183) 1.3 g/cm³
Filament diameter 1.75
Filament tolerance +/- 0.02 mm
Filament length 159.9
Filament length 159.9

Printing properties

Printing temperature 250ºC-265 ºC
Print bed temperature 85

Mechanical properties

Izod impact strength (ISO 180) 3 KJ/m²
Charpy impact strength (ISO 180) 3 KJ/m²
Elongation at break (ISO 527) 5 %

Due to the presence of nanoparticles, the filament's structure is not completely smooth. Thickness variations are natural but do not affect the correct filament diameter, which remains within the declared range. Because of the possibility of nanoparticle buildup, a 0.6 mm nozzle is recommended, and if the nozzle becomes clogged, the printing temperature should be increased. Due to strong bed adhesion, printing directly on the surface or on glass is not recommended, as this may cause damage. The use of adhesive tape is recommended for protection.
